She's been on paid leave since June of 2009. And now an East Valley teacher, Michele Taylor acquitted of sexual misconduct charges is able to keep her teaching certificate. The State Office of Public Instruction pulled Taylors' license to teach in June but she appealed. The board recently decided to impose a one year suspension instead of revoking the certificate. Taylor was acquitted last June of charges that she had sex with a 16 year old student.
